Transaction 5705c727ef79468b76d89786222617b1a57f3a79c7465a5884a791696febec45
1 Input
1 Output
-
5705c727ef79468b76d89786222617b1a57f3a79c7465a5884a791696febec45:0
- value
- 21228
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fbe984f308ba6ab986adb64375c19ba62ea87a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KwTCUmZWarEbZvm7P62TEFb6n5B7L9xLz